探索jQuery的拖拽功能

166 2024-09-07 20:23

介绍jQuery拖拽功能

jQuery是一种广泛使用的JavaScript库,为开发者提供了丰富的功能和便利的API,其中包括了拖拽功能。拖拽是指通过鼠标点击并拖动页面元素,实现元素的移动、重排或与其他元素的交互效果。在网页开发中,拖拽功能可以增强用户的交互体验,使页面更加灵活和直观。本文将探讨如何使用jQuery实现拖拽功能,并介绍一些相关的用法和技巧。

如何使用jQuery实现拖拽功能

首先,我们需要引入jQuery库,并确保其正确加载到页面中。然后,我们可以使用jQuery提供的方法来实现拖拽功能。常用的拖拽方法包括draggable()和droppable()。draggable()方法用于将元素设为可拖拽,而droppable()方法用于定义可拖拽元素的目标区域。通过这两个方法的组合使用,我们可以实现元素间的拖拽和放置操作。例如,我们可以将一个图片元素设为可拖拽,并定义另外一个元素作为接受拖拽的目标区域。当用户拖拽图片元素并释放鼠标时,图片元素将被放置到目标区域中。

拖拽功能的常用参数和事件

在使用draggable()和droppable()方法时,我们可以传入一些参数来定制拖拽功能的行为。这些参数包括设置拖拽元素的约束范围、设置拖拽辅助的样式和设置拖拽过程中的回调函数等。同时,拖拽功能也触发了一些事件,我们可以通过监听这些事件来响应用户的操作。常见的拖拽事件包括拖拽开始(dragstart)、拖拽过程(drag)、拖拽结束(dragend)和放置(drop)。通过绑定这些事件的处理函数,我们可以在拖拽过程中实现一些功能,如改变元素的样式或移动元素的位置等。

拖拽功能的应用场景

拖拽功能在网页开发中有着广泛的应用场景。例如,在在线购物网站中,我们可以使用拖拽功能实现购物车的添加和删除操作。用户可以将商品拖拽到购物车图标上,或是将已选商品从购物车中拖出进行删除。另外,拖拽功能还可以用于页面布局的实现。我们可以将页面中的模块设为可拖拽,并实现动态调整页面结构的效果。此外,拖拽功能还可应用于拖拽排序、拖拽调整大小等需求,为用户提供更好的操作方式和用户体验。

结语

通过使用jQuery的拖拽功能,我们可以为网页增加更加灵活和直观的交互效果。通过对draggable()和droppable()方法的使用,以及对常用参数和事件的了解,我们可以快速实现拖拽功能,并根据实际需求添加一些定制化的功能。希望本文对你理解和使用jQuery的拖拽功能有所帮助,谢谢阅读!

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片